Personal Details and Bio Data
Detail | Information |
---|---|
Full Name | Jami Beth Gertz |
Birthdate | October 28, 1965 |
Birthplace | Chicago, Illinois, USA |
Career Start | Early 1980s |
Notable Roles (General) | Actress in film and television, including sitcoms. |
Spouse | Tony Ressler |
Children | Three sons |

"Still Standing" (2002-2006): A Family Comedy Hit
"Still Standing" truly became a cornerstone of Jami Gertz's sitcom career, running for several seasons in the early 2000s. In this show, she played Judy Miller, a wife and mother trying to raise her kids alongside her husband, Bill, in a suburban setting. "The Neighbors" (2012-2014): Out-of-This-World Humor
Later in her career, Jami Gertz took on a very different kind of sitcom with "The Neighbors." In this series, she played Debbie Weaver, a woman whose family moves into a new community only to discover their neighbors are, in fact, aliens.
